About Versailles Elementary School
Versailles Elementary School serves 472 students in kindergarten through fourth grade in Versailles, Ohio. The school carries a composite score of 9.0 out of 10 — rated Exceptional — with near-perfect marks of 9.9 in both academics and growth. That rare alignment of high achievement and accelerating student progress distinguishes it in a state with more than 3,400 public schools.
The data backs that claim directly. Versailles Elementary ranks 24th among 1,742 Ohio elementary schools, putting it in the top 2 percent of its direct peer group statewide. Across all public schools in Ohio — elementary through high school — it outperforms 98 percent, landing at #51 overall.
These are not outlier-year results; the consistency across both the academic and growth dimensions points to a school operating at a high level year over year. The school runs as a regular public school with a student-teacher ratio of 18.2 to 1. It ranks first among the three public schools in Versailles.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has remained stable from 90% (2019) to 92% (2021). Reading/ELA proficiency has improved from 81% (2019) to 92% (2021).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Versailles Elementary School has a median household income of $84,388. It is an area where 25%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$232,400, with a median rent of $732/month. The local poverty rate of 5.6%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 21 minutes.
